Transaction 366f1d32b5ce137d24e4b33cdc61f76157ade3eb535a07f4decb55f18d8c66f4

1 Input
2 Outputs
  • 366f1d32b5ce137d24e4b33cdc61f76157ade3eb535a07f4decb55f18d8c66f4:0
  • value  18080
    address  15AbmYdPrBfansHjcaGwZ1TjfxDzqiaioH
  • 366f1d32b5ce137d24e4b33cdc61f76157ade3eb535a07f4decb55f18d8c66f4:1
  • value  268707
    address  3MAXz4s7w96uqB2zu1ukYkhGuzj9DnJ3f2